She was married October 25, 1858, to Willaim (William) Hall, Jr. Born in Lancashire, England, October 9, 1838, and was a daughter of John and Jane (Wood) Green, the latter of whom came to Kendall County in 1856, and purchased a farm the same year.

Mr. and Mrs. John Green had children named as follows:
George is a physician living at Mitchell, Dakota;
Thomas is a farmer near Fairmont, Nebraska;
John was a physician and died in California;
Mary is the wife of Charles Barnett, a merchant in Grafton, Nebraska;
Ann is the wife of James Goostrey, a farmer residing in Fillmore County;
Jane is now the wife of Obadiah Naden, a retired farmer of Morris, Illinois;
Sarah is the wife of the William Hall.

Sarah and her husband, William, have had seven children, named George, William, Hattie, Ida, Frank, Mary and Lida, all at present living with their parents except Hattie, who married Frank Baker and resides in this township. Mrs. Hall, the two eldest sons, and Hattie, are members of the Congregational Church at Lisbon.

- Genealogical and Biographical Record of KENDALL County, Illinois,
1900,
page 986
